Prasanto is derived from the Sanskrit root 'prasanta', meaning calm, peaceful, or serene. It is traditionally used in Indian cultures to denote tranquility of mind and spirit. Historically, it reflects a valued state of mental clarity and composure in Hindu philosophy and classical literature, symbolizing inner peace and harmony.

Cultural Significance of Prasanto

In Indian culture, the name Prasanto is deeply associated with spiritual calmness and mental peace, virtues highly esteemed in Hinduism and Buddhism. The concept of 'prasanta manas' (peaceful mind) is central to meditation and yoga traditions, making the name symbolic of inner tranquility and balance. It is often chosen to reflect aspirations for a calm, compassionate life.

Prasanta Chandra Mahalanobis

Indian scientist and statistician, founder of the Indian Statistical Institute and known for the Mahalanobis distance.
